Are you a peanut-free school?

Yes, we are a nut-free school. We take allergies seriously and ask that all families avoid sending nut products to ensure a safe environment for all children. If your child has additional allergies, please inform us so we can accommodate their needs.

What should my child bring each day?

We recommend sending a backpack with a water bottle, weather-appropriate clothing, inside shoes, a change of clothes, diapers, wipes. If your child is not using our meal service, please provide nut free snacks and lunch.

Do you operate year-round?

Yes, we are open year-round with the exception of a two-week closure during the winter break.

What’s the maximum enrollment?

Maximum of 18 children for Moncton location and 24 for Bayview location.

Can parents apply for the Affordable Child Care Benefit (ACCB)?

Yes, both of our locations are eligible for ACCB, which can help reduce the cost of care for families who qualify.

Are meals or snacks provided?

We partner with a catering company that offers daily meal deliveries for families who choose to use this service. Parents are also welcome to send food from home if preferred.

Do children have nap time?

Yes. While nap time is not mandatory, children who need rest will have a quiet, comfortable space to nap.
